A quick word on the goods lift at Ferrowynd House: it's reserved for deliveries and facilities work, full stop. If you're escorting a visitor, use the main passenger lifts by reception — even if the goods lift looks quicker and emptier. Couriers with large items should be directed to the loading bay on Thistle Row, where the Daybright team will sign things in. If you genuinely need the goods lift for an approved move, Facilities will walk you through it, and you'll need the lift door code below.

door code, kawip-bagap: bdg-HQEWH-4

Onboarding note for the Ledgerpane admin table: bulk edits are applied through the batcher service, not directly against the database. Select rows, choose an action, and the batcher stages changes in a pending set you can review before commit. Edits over 500 rows require a second approver — this is enforced server-side, so don't try to chunk around it. To run the batcher locally you need the staging write credential, which goes in your .env as the next line.

secret setting of bahip-kagag: RELAY_SECRET3=c83

Break-glass access — fleet fuel-usage report. Plugin authors integrating with the Cartwheel fleet API normally read fuel-usage reports through scoped tokens. If the token service is down and a customer needs the monthly report urgently, break-glass access is available through the Oxbridge-Hollow emergency endpoint. Use it only when the outage banner is active, and file an access note within 24 hours. The endpoint accepts a single standing passphrase, which is:

vault phrase of yahif-hahaf = istael-gorir-fenwyn-belael-novys-novok-juldor

## Goods Lift — Delivery Use Only

The goods lift at Stallen Wharf is reserved exclusively for deliveries and approved equipment moves. New starters should never use it for personal trips, even with bulky bags — the passenger lifts are adjacent. Bookings for large moves go through the Hauler calendar at least two days ahead. The lift lobby door on each floor is kept locked; when escorting a delivery, open it with the code below.

staff pass of kawip-hawef = bdg-QLP-2